Our apartment is located in the heart of Adams Morgan neighborhood, right off 18th Street NW and Calvert St NW, and a few blocks from the Woodley Park Metro Station and the National Zoo. In this vibrant, cosmopolitan, neighborhood, you will find some of the city's finest restaurants, historic homes as well as an array of unique bookstores, and Washington's largest concentration of art displays.

KEY LOCATIONS & DISTANCES FROM APARTMENT: ~UNION STATION: 23 minute drive/1 hr 14 minute walk/ 31 minute transit ride (red line). ~METRO: 12-15 minute walk (Woodley Park Zoo/Adams Morgan red line). ~BUS: lines 90, 96, L2, WP-AM, X3 stops are right in front of the unit ~WALTER E. WASH CONVENTION CENTER: 15 minute drive/50 minute walk/20 minute public transit (96 bus to green line). ~OMNI HOTEL: 3 minute drive/ 15 minute walk/ 8 minute L2 bus ride. ~NATIONAL MALL: 20 minute drive/ 1 hr 11 minute walk/ 30-40 minute public transit (90 bus & green line). ~NATIONAL CATHEDRAL:10 minute drive/ 45 minute walk/ 20 minute bus ride (96 bus). ~RONALD REAGAN AIRPORT: 25 minute drive/ 2 hr 30 minute walk/ 40-50 minute public transit ride ( L2 to blue line OR green line to yellow line). ~WASHINGTON DULLES INTERNATIONAL AIRPORT: 40 minute drive/ 1 hr and 25 minute public transit (L2 to silver line). ~BWI THURGOOD MARSHALL AIRPORT: 1 hr 10 minute drive/ Public transit 1 hr and 25 minute ride (red line to Amtrak).

Dirty Dingy Basement
Unfortunately, we did not enjoy our stay and cannot recommend this accommodation to other travelers. What was good: location, prompt responses and generally kind hosts.Bad: everything else. Mold in the shower (hosts said "you can throw out the mat and it should rinse away" when asked to clean it). The shower curtain was so rusted and full of mildew that we went out and bought a replacement for the month we were there. Dust, dead bugs, dirt everywhere. The lighting was extremely dim. No natural light, windows were dirty. Weird smell. EXTREMELY uncomfortable beds. The wifi did not extend to the back room (to the hosts credit, they did come fix it and it worked for about 4 days before not working again). Limited cell service in the apartment. The hosts asked us to let a potential tenant in to tour the place while we were staying here to which we declined. Water damage in the kitchen and rusted dishwasher. At the rate we were paying for this place, "luxury" is absolutely laughable. Everything is outdated and uncomfortable and not clean, it all made for a rather unpleasant experience.

Cute area but very dirty
While the neighborhood was wonderful and the owners seem nice. They were not responsive (action wise) to our concerns. The apartment's dishwasher had black mold the entire time we were there (10 weeks). If the dishwasher was opened it would make the entire apartment smell like decay/mold. When we asked for it to be fixed--the first week--we were told that we were just not using the garbage disposal correctly (this happened twice) and that we should clean it out ourselves. We were hand washing the entire time. The rest of the property needs to be revamped. The bedding and the couch has the slight smell of body odor that does not go away. The shower mat also seems like it has not been cleaned in years and there were bugs everywhere. The wifi did not work in the back part of the apartment. We also met our upstairs neighbors and they were paying a lot less for a backyard, full kitchen, and sunlight. Overall, while I did love the location, the basement apartment itself needs a lot of work and updating. This basement apartment could do well if it just had some investment.
